Work is required if you want to keep your electric patio heater maintained. You should not compromise with quality and safety. Therefore, maintenance procedure should be followed strictly.

You will have to pay more on the electricity bill for electric patio heater. Without proper maintenance, you can expect more energy consumption as your heater gets older. Checking them often up will save you a lot of money. This will keep it running longer and smoother.

There will be some effort required on your behalf in order to maintain your electric patio heater. It’s quite simple really. All you need to do is follow these steps.

• There are a few things you should take note. Make sure there are no cracks and rusting. Other than that, tighten loose screws, wires and bolt if any. Electric shocks and fire can happen as a result of open wire.

• Dirt should not be left to build up near the heat source. Clogging inside the heater would require professional maintenance. Paying them is better than doing it yourself as you might cause problems to your machine. It could also be dangerous to you.

• Just as the inside needs to always be dirt-free, the outside of your electric patio heater should also be dusted regularly. When cleaning your heater, use a dry cloth with a dab of cleaning solution, a soft brush, or a small vacuum cleaner. Usually, unless otherwise noted, only the base of the heater can be rinsed with water.

• The heater should be routinely checked at least once a year. This will make sure your heater will run smoothly and at its optimum level.

• A good number of the heaters available in the market have metal parts that are sharp and may cause injury. Always read your electric patio heater’s manual before attempting to clean or open it up. Manufacturer’s usually have safety precautions printed in your unit’s manual. Taking time to scan this will save you from wasting more time trying to dress a wounded arm.

Carelessness is the usual culprit for most home based accidents. Extreme caution must be observed especially with handling equipment such as electric patio heaters. For one thing, heaters are called such because they provide artificial heat, thus, there is a great possibility that, through innocent carelessness, your house may catch fire or someone might seriously get hurt. To avoid such untoward incidents, the following precautions should be followed:

• Outdoor heating units are not toys so never let children play with them.

• Gasoline, liquefied petroleum gas, paint thinner, and kerosene are flammable so keep them away from your electric heaters.

• There is no need for you to check on your electric heaters every now and then when you have turned them on. They are automatic so they heat the area instantly and for a long period of time. If you are leaving the area, turn them off.

• If there is rain, you might need to cover your electric heater. If you buy waterproof heaters, you can save yourself from all the troubles of running to get covers.

Oil Burner Control


Oil Burner Control


$78.05


Provides automatic, nonrecycling control of an intermittent ignition oil burner system. Controls oil burner, oil valve (if desired) and the ignition transformer in response to a call for heat. Solid state flame sensing circuit. LED on terminal strip indicates system lockout. Enclosed safety switch with external reset button. Manual trip lever opens safety switch for system maintenance. Mounts on standard 4 x 4 junction box. C554A cadmium sulfide flame detector and 24V thermostat required.
